Output 5ba8ac93ac54f98c9dc60408daf0294c29d391d536a1034d6417a7832c1213a8:1

value
71168518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2242b49129694889be7c2b9ae045a399e68da1dd OP_EQUAL
address
34pAoqLiX7LCGuHNcgD23SKxpePCKEgRkU
transaction
5ba8ac93ac54f98c9dc60408daf0294c29d391d536a1034d6417a7832c1213a8
confirmations
419259
spent
true